Secret #3: Hold the Reset Button (Long-Press Technique)
When your controller refuses to pair, the universal reset command works wonders. Locate the small reset button on the back (around the USB port), press and hold it for 10-15 seconds while charging the controller via USB. This forces a fresh handshake, restarting the controller’s internal pairing protocol—often connecting you in under 10 seconds.
